Can You Improve Periodontitis Treatments?

Can You Improve Periodontitis Treatments?

Written By Kevin Kerfoot / Reviewed By Ray Spotts

Periodontitis - or gum disease - is an inflammation of the gums and supporting structures of the teeth. It is one of the most common chronic diseases in the world, and in Germany, approximately 15 percent of people are affected by a particularly severe form of this disease. If left untreated, periodontitis will lead to tooth loss, and the disease also increases the risk of arthritis, cardiovascular disease and cancer.

Has A New Treatment Method For Periodontal Disease Been Found?

Has A New Treatment Method For Periodontal Disease Been Found?

Written By Kevin Kerfoot / Reviewed By Ray Spotts

Periodontal disease is widespread and usually caused by bacteria, which leads to an inflammation of the gums - or periodontitis. New biodegradable rods promise to provide better treatment for periodontal disease, and researchers from the Institute of Pharmacy at Martin Luther University Halle-Wittenberg (MLU) have re-combined an already approved active ingredient and filed for a patent for their invention together with two Fraunhofer Institutes from Halle.

How To Avoid Swollen Gums And What To Do When You Get Them

How To Avoid Swollen Gums And What To Do When You Get Them

Reviewed By Ray Spotts
 

When your gums are healthy, they’re a nice light pink. But when they’re swollen, they’re in need of dental care with the guidance of your dentist. Swollen gums may appear to bulge out near where they meet with the teeth. They also look red rather than pink.
